Down The Hatch By:
Steve Thompson |
This story was related to me by some other
fitters. They were standing around on top of a hopper where they had
gone to fix the mechanism that filled it. Along comes teh foreman
Bobby Gill sometimes known as Gobby Bill,
full of managerial bluster. The following is the script of the
pantomime that followed
Down The Hatch
Foreman. What are
you lot f...ing doing standing around here? Fitter We can't
reach the chute from here, we've sent for a ladder. Foreman
You don't need a f...ing ladder, here give me that
spanner
(reaches out precariously one hand on a rail, the other clutching
the
spanner) Sound FX
Whoosh, Scream, Thud Foreman (shouting from bottom of hopper) GO GET A
LADDER! Fitters (in unison) YOU DON'T
NEED A F...ING LADDER!
